``webvtt-py`` is a Python module for reading/writing WebVTT_ caption files. It also features caption segmentation useful when captioning `HLS videos`_.

Requires Python 3.4+.

Installation
------------

::

    $ pip install webvtt-py

Usage
-----

.. code-block:: python

  import webvtt

  for caption in webvtt.read('captions.vtt'):
      print(caption.start)
      print(caption.end)
      print(caption.text)

Segmenting for HLS
------------------

.. code-block:: python

  import webvtt

  webvtt.segment('captions.vtt', 'output/path')

Converting captions from other formats
--------------------------------------

Supported formats:

* SubRip (.srt)
* YouTube SBV (.sbv)

.. code-block:: python

  import webvtt

  webvtt = webvtt.from_srt('captions.srt')
  webvtt.save()

  # one liner if we just need to convert without editing
  webvtt.from_sbv('captions.sbv').save()

CLI
---
Caption segmentation is also available from the command line:
::

    $ webvtt segment captions.vtt --output destination/directoy
